How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 78666?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 78666 Studio Apartments | $1,161 | $700 | $1,973 |
| 78666 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,241 | $663 | $2,730 |
| 78666 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,458 | $725 | $3,825 |
| 78666 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,634 | $750 | $5,394 |
| 78666 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,197 | $600 | $5,184 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 78666 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 78666?
There are currently 29 Studio Apartments in 78666 with rent ranges from $700 to $1,973 with an average price of $1,161.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 78666 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 78666 ranges from $663 to $2,730 with an average monthly rent of $1,241.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 78666 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 78666 range from $725 to $3,825.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,458.
How expensive are 78666 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 111 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 78666 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$750 to $5,394 - averaging $1,634 for the location.
